Gold is a precious metal that has been prized for its beauty, rarity, and chemical stability for thousands of years. In the adult toy industry, gold appears primarily in two forms: solid gold or gold alloy used in intimate jewellery and accessories, and gold plating applied over a base metal such as stainless steel or brass.
In the context of sex toys and accessories, solid gold is used for intimate jewellery, body adornments, and very high-end decorative accessories. Gold-plated adult toys are more common in the premium market, where the gold finish provides visual luxury over a functional base material.
The surface of polished gold is very smooth, warm-toned, and highly reflective. It feels dense and cool to the touch, warming quickly with body contact.
Gold is generally considered body-safe, though the specific form and purity matter significantly.
Pure Gold: Pure gold (24 karat) is hypoallergenic, non-porous, and chemically inert, making it an excellent body-safe material. It does not tarnish or react with skin.
Gold Alloys: Lower karat gold, such as 18k or 14k, is mixed with other metals including silver, copper, or nickel to add hardness. These alloys can cause reactions in people with sensitivities to the alloying metals, particularly nickel.
Gold Plating: Gold-plated adult toys are only as safe as the plating thickness and the base material beneath. Thin gold plating can wear through over time, exposing the base material. If the base is brass or a lower-quality metal, this can become a safety concern.
Non-Porous: Gold in all its forms is non-porous, making it hygienic and easy to clean as long as the surface is intact.
Overall, solid high-karat gold is a top-tier body-safe material, while gold-plated products require more careful attention to plating integrity over time.
